Abstract

PURPOSE:To easily produce an artificial flower having reality using an easily available thin film such as tissue paper. CONSTITUTION:A core member 1 is produced by forming a resin part 3, having slight viscosity on its surface, serving as a film-fixing means on its tips of a core body 2 consisting of a wire, etc. The resin part 3 of the core member 1 is pressed at the nearly central part of a sheet of a developed tissue paper by holding the core body 2. When the resin part 3 is rolled, the tissue paper 4 is rolled up by the core body 1 wherein the tissue paper draws a spiral around the resin part 3 as a center. In this state, the tissue paper 4 forms a shape very much like a natural rose flower. This is fixed by rolling with a tape 6 and optionally artificial leaves 5 are attached. Thus, an artificial flower is produced of tissue paper in a very short time.

Reference numeral 3 is a resin portion which is a thin film locking means provided at the tip of the shaft body 2. As will be described later, it is desirable that the resin portion 3 has irregularities formed on the surface in order to entangle a thin film such as thin paper. In addition, the resin itself is a resin whose surface retains a certain degree of viscosity and elasticity (viscoelasticity),
For example, ethylene / vinyl acetate copolymer (EVA) is suitable. It is known that EVA has different properties depending on the content of vinyl acetate. If the content of vinyl acetate is low, the hardness increases and the mechanical properties become good. On the other hand, if the content of vinyl acetate is increased, the resin becomes The whole will have rubber-like properties. In the case of the present invention, EVA having a high vinyl acetate content is used so that the resin portion 3 as the thin film locking means has viscoelasticity similar to rubber. Further, in this case, it is preferable that the resin forming the resin portion 3 is impregnated with a desired fragrance so that the artificial flowers emit fragrance. By the way, in the case of a high-molecular compound of EVA grade, a fragrance molecule is favorably introduced between the molecules, so that the scent of the resin part is relatively easy. In addition to the synthetic resins typified by EVA, natural resins secreted by plants such as pine resin can also be used.

FIG. 3 shows a state where a rose artificial flower is created by using the shaft member 1 and tissue paper as a thin paper. First, the tissue paper 4 is placed on a flat surface such as a table. In this state, the shaft body 2 of the shaft member 1 is held and the tip of the resin portion 3 is pressed against the tissue paper 4. In this case, the resin part 3 is arranged almost in the center of the tissue paper 4, but if the resin part 3 is arranged eccentrically from the complete center position, the petals of the peripheral part of the rose petals created will be somewhat larger and more realistic. It can be an artificial flower.

【0012】次に前記軸体2を所定の方向に回転させる
と、樹脂部3を中心としてティッシュペーパー4が絡み
付くように巻き取られ、その巻き取られた部分は全体と
しては螺旋を描き、これらが花びらとして認識されるよ
うな形状となる。この場合紙としてのティッシュペーパ
ー4が持つ強度によりティッシュペーパー4自体は樹脂
部3の回転に対応して円滑な螺旋を描くのではなく、図
6に示す如くある程度折れ線を形成するような状態で螺
旋を描くため、期せずして実際のバラにより近い形状と
なる。因に実際のバラはツボミ内に螺旋状に収容されて
いる各々の花びらが、螺旋状に解けるようにして開花す
るわけであるが、本発明における造花製作時のティッシ
ュペーパー4の挙動は実際のバラの開花における逆の行
程を経て形成されるものである。
Next, when the shaft body 2 is rotated in a predetermined direction, the tissue paper 4 is wound around the resin portion 3 so as to be entangled, and the wound portion draws a spiral as a whole. Will be recognized as a petal. In this case, due to the strength of the tissue paper 4 as paper, the tissue paper 4 itself does not draw a smooth spiral corresponding to the rotation of the resin portion 3, but spirals to a certain extent as shown in FIG. Since it is drawn, the shape will be closer to the actual rose. By the way, in actual roses, each petal housed in a spiral in the acupuncture tree blooms so that it can be unwound in a spiral manner. However, the behavior of the tissue paper 4 during artificial flower production in the present invention is the actual behavior. It is formed through the reverse process of rose flowering.
